What Should You Know Before Selling a Cartier Watch?

Selling a Cartier watch requires careful preparation to maximize its value and ensure a smooth transaction. These luxury timepieces hold significant worth due to their craftsmanship, history, and brand prestige. Understanding the process helps sellers avoid pitfalls and achieve fair prices in the pre-owned market.

How Do You Authenticate a Cartier Watch Before Selling?

Authentication is the first step when selling a Cartier watch. Examine the serial number engraved on the case back, which should match Cartier’s records. Check for hallmarks like the jeweler’s mark and material stamps indicating gold or platinum content. The movement should operate smoothly, with precise timekeeping typical of Cartier’s engineering.

Professional appraisal verifies genuineness. Look for telltale signs of fakes, such as poor etching or mismatched fonts on dials. Authentic pieces often come with original boxes and papers, boosting credibility during the selling process.

What Factors Determine the Value of a Cartier Watch?

Several elements influence the price when selling a Cartier watch. Model rarity plays a key role; limited editions or vintage designs command premiums. Condition is crucial—scratches, dents, or worn parts reduce value significantly.

Market demand fluctuates based on trends and economic conditions. Gold or diamond-set models appreciate with material prices. Provenance, like celebrity ownership, can elevate worth. Comparable sales data from recent auctions provides a benchmark for realistic pricing.

Where Are the Best Places for Selling a Cartier Watch?

Options for selling a Cartier watch include specialized luxury watch dealers who offer expert evaluations and immediate payments. Auction houses handle high-end pieces, potentially yielding top bids from collectors. Online platforms connect sellers with global buyers but require caution against scams.

Private sales through trusted networks minimize fees but demand verification. Each venue suits different priorities: speed, maximum return, or discretion. Research fees and buyer reliability before committing.

What Documents Should You Gather When Selling a Cartier Watch?

Original documentation enhances trust and value. The certificate of authenticity, warranty card, and purchase receipt prove ownership history. Service records from authorized centers demonstrate maintenance.

A recent independent appraisal report adds objectivity. Without these, buyers may discount the price or walk away. Organize everything in a folder for easy presentation during the selling process.

How Do You Prepare a Cartier Watch for Sale?

Cleaning and servicing prepare the watch optimally. Polish the case and bracelet gently to restore shine without removing patina on vintage models. A professional service ensures mechanical reliability.

High-quality photos from multiple angles highlight details. Accurate descriptions note specifics like reference numbers and complications. Pricing competitively based on market comps attracts serious inquiries when selling a Cartier watch.

What Common Mistakes Should You Avoid When Selling a Cartier Watch?

Rushing the sale often leads to undervaluation; patience uncovers better offers. Ignoring authentication invites disputes. Overlooking market timing, like selling during low demand, hurts returns.

Failing to disclose flaws erodes trust. Choosing unvetted buyers risks non-payment or fraud. Always use secure shipping with insurance for mailed transactions.

What Are the Tax Implications of Selling a Cartier Watch?

Profits from selling a Cartier watch may incur capital gains tax if the sale exceeds purchase price adjusted for inflation. Keep records for tax reporting. Consult local regulations, as rules vary by jurisdiction.

Gifts or inheritances have different treatments. Professional advice ensures compliance without surprises.

How much is a Cartier watch worth when selling?

Value ranges from thousands to hundreds of thousands, depending on model, condition, and rarity. Appraisals provide precise estimates.

Can you sell a Cartier watch without papers?

Yes, but expect a 20-50% discount. Authentication compensates partially, yet papers verify history.

Is now a good time for selling a Cartier watch?

Timing depends on market trends; luxury watches often hold value well amid economic shifts. Monitor auction results.
